随着区块链技术的迅猛发展,其在各行各业的应用也愈发广泛。其中,许多新术语、新缩写相继出现,让不少人感到困惑。在这些新兴概念中,DFS这一缩写逐渐引起了越来越多人的关注。那么,DFS在区块链技术中到底意味着什么?它的运作原理、实际应用又是什么?在接下来的内容中,我们将详细探讨DFS的含义及其在区块链中的重要性。
DFS是“Distributed File System”的缩写,翻译为中文是“分布式文件系统”。它是一种数据存储架构,通过将文件分散存储在多个地点,从而实现数据的高效管理、快速访问和高可用性。传统的文件系统通常依赖集中式服务器来存储和管理数据,而DFS则通过区块链技术的去中心化特性,能够在多个网络节点上分布存储数据。这样一来,即使某些节点出现故障,数据也不会丢失。
在区块链环境中,DFS通过一组分布式节点来实现文件的存储和管理。这些节点可以是世界各地的用户,也可以是各种设备。每当用户上传文件时,文件会被分割成多个块(chunk),并分别存储在不同的节点上。每个块都会被加密并附带路由信息,以便在需要时可以快速找到相应的数据块。
用户在请求文件时,DFS系统会通过一种智能合约或直接的索引查找机制,获取所有分布在各个节点上的数据块。获取到所有块后,通过重组的方式将文件还原为原始状态。这个过程保证了数据的完整性和一致性。
DFS在区块链应用中的优势主要体现在以下几点:
如今,许多区块链项目开始尝试引入DFS技术,例如IPFS(InterPlanetary File System)就一个非常典型的例子。IPFS是一个去中心化的文件存储网络,通过利用DFS的技术,使用户能够快速、安全地共享文件。此外,许多项目正在探索如何将DFS与其他技术结合,实现更高效的内容分发、数据库管理等功能。以西方一些大型科技公司为例,他们正在使用DFS来加强云存储的安全性与效率。
传统文件系统往往是集中式的,所有的数据存储和管理均依赖企业内部的服务器。而DFS则基于去中心化技术,数据分散存储在多个节点中,这样即使某些节点不可用,数据仍能完整存取。
另一个显著差异在于数据的安全性。在传统文件系统中,数据容易受到集中攻击,黑客可以通过攻击单一的入口来获取数据。而DFS则通过加密和分散存储来增强数据保护,即使部分节点遭到攻击,也不会影响整个系统。
另外,DFS的扩展性和灵活性也远远高于传统系统。当需要存储更多数据时,只需增加更多的节点即可。而在传统系统中,扩展往往涉及昂贵的硬件和复杂的软件升级。
DFS在区块链中有许多实际应用场景,以下是几个显著的例子:
除此之外,DFS还被应用于人工智能、大数据分析等领域,通过分散式存储增强数据处理能力。
实施DFS技术需要一定的技术储备和基础设施。首先,企业或组织需要选择适合的区块链平台,并搭建基本的区块链网络。这一步骤涉及到节点的部署和配置。在一个理想的情况下,越多的节点参与进去,系统的安全性和可用性越高。
接下来,需要设计合适的数据分布策略,如何将数据划分为合理的块、如何加密和管理这些数据至关重要。同时,必须充分考虑网络的带宽与延迟,以确保在数据传输时不会影响用户体验。
最后,为了让用户能够顺利使用这个系统,建立一个友好的用户界面和开发相应的API也是不可或缺的。完成技术实现后,还需要进行充分的测试,确保系统的稳定和安全。
随着区块链技术的不断进步,DFS在未来也将呈现出多样化的发展趋势。首先,随着5G技术的推广,数据传输的速度将进一步提升,这会促进DFS在实时性要求更高的场景中的应用。
其次,AI与区块链的融合将使DFS的管理与操作变得更加智能高效。通过引入机器学习算法,DFS系统能够不断数据存取的路径和方式,提高用户体验和存储效率。
最后,随着全球对数据隐私的重视提高,去中心化的文件存储方案将成为越来越多企业的选择。在这一过程中,DFS不仅将成为技术解决方案,还能推动数据安全标准的制定和完善。
DFS作为区块链技术中的一个重要组成部分,通过分散存储数据,提升了数据的安全性、可靠性和易用性。它不仅在数字内容分发、医疗记录存储等领域展现了广泛的应用潜力,也为未来的技术创新打开了一扇新窗。理解DFS的基本概念及其在区块链中的应用,无疑是把握未来技术发展的重要一步。